James E. Johnson (Jim)

Posted By Kyle Nikola On February 9, 2022 @ 2:27 pm In Obituaries | 1 Comment

James E. Johnson (Jim), 82, of Richmond Hill, died January 29, 2022 at Hospice Savannah, Georgia of the last stages of Dementia.
The native of Kannapolis, North Carolina was a salesman for Underground Utilities. He was a member of New Beginnings Church of Richmond Hill, Georgia. He was a member of G.O.B.&A, serving 2 terms as President.
Survivors: his wife Irene (Cookie) of 42 years; daughter, Beth Maurer of Jacksonville, Florida; granddaughter, Maria Smith of Jacksonville, Florida; granddaughter, Melody Litwin of Jacksonville, Florida; stepdaughter, Jennifer Kook of Savannah, Georgia; stepdaughter, Kimberly Drake of Asheboro, North Carolina; great grandsons, Powell and Mathew of Jacksonville, Florida.
Visitation will be 1 to 3 pm, Saturday February 12, 2022 at New Beginnings Church, Hwy 144 in Richmond Hill. Service to follow.
